CVE-2008-2565 is a SQL injection issue in PHP Address Book. A remote attacker could manipulate address-book pages to run unauthorized database commands. For an exposed legacy install, this could mean contact data disclosure, data changes, or database disruption. Exposure is most likely where legacy PHP Address Book 3.1.5 or earlier, and reportedly 4.0.x, remains reachable from the internet or internal users. Prioritize remediation for any reachable deployment. The software appears old, exploit references are public, and the issue can affect database confidentiality and integrity. If the product is still business-critical, isolate it while confirming upgrade or replacement options. Mitigation focus: Inventory and remove any unused PHP Address Book deployments.; Check vendor or maintainer guidance for patched versions or supported migration paths.; Restrict network access to trusted users until remediation is complete..
